/ProjectConfig (devenv.exe)/ProjectConfig (devenv.exe)

/project 引数で指定されたプロジェクトをビルド、消去、リビルド、または展開する際に適用されるプロジェクトのビルド構成を指定します。Specifies a project build configuration to be applied when you build, clean, rebuild, or deploy the project named in the /project argument.

構文Syntax

devenv SolutionName {/build|/clean|/rebuild|/deploy} SolnConfigName [/project ProjName] [/projectconfig ProjConfigName]

引数Arguments

/build/build /project 引数で指定されたプロジェクトをビルドします。Builds the project specified by the /project argument.
/clean/clean ビルド時に作成されたすべての中間ファイルと出力ディレクトリを消去します。Cleans all intermediary files and output directories created during a build.
/rebuild/rebuild /project 引数で指定されたプロジェクトを消去してからビルドします。Cleans then builds the project specified by the /project argument.
/deploy/deploy ビルドまたはリビルド後にプロジェクトを展開することを指定します。Specifies that the project be deployed after a build or rebuild.
SolnConfigNameSolnConfigName 必須。Required. SolutionName で指定されたソリューションに適用されるソリューション構成の名前。The name of the solution configuration that will be applied to the solution named in SolutionName. 複数のソリューション プラットフォームが利用できる場合、"Debug|Win32" など、プラットフォームも指定する必要があります。If multiple solution platforms are available, you must also specify the platform, for example "Debug|Win32".
SolutionNameSolutionName 必須。Required. ソリューション ファイルの完全パスと名前。The full path and name of the solution file.
/project ProjName/project ProjName 任意。Optional. ソリューション内のプロジェクト ファイルのパスと名前です。The path and name of a project file within the solution. SolutionName フォルダーからプロジェクト ファイルへの相対パス、プロジェクトの表示名、プロジェクト ファイルの完全なパスと名前を入力できます。You can enter a relative path from the SolutionName folder to the project file, or the project's display name, or the full path and name of the project file.
/projectconfig ProjConfigName/projectconfig ProjConfigName 任意。Optional. /project 引数で指定されたプロジェクトに適用されるプロジェクトのビルド構成の名前。The name of a project build configuration to be applied to the project specified by the /project argument. 複数のソリューション プラットフォームが利用できる場合、"Debug|Win32" など、プラットフォームも指定する必要があります。If multiple solution platforms are available, you must also specify the platform, for example "Debug|Win32".

コメントRemarks

/projectconfig スイッチは、/build/clean/rebuild/deploy コマンドの一部として /project スイッチと共に使用する必要があります。The /projectconfig switch must be used with the /project switch as part of a /build, /clean, /rebuild, or /deploy command.

空白を含む文字列を二重引用符で囲みます。Enclose strings that include spaces in double quotes.

エラーなどのビルドの概要情報は、[コマンド] ウィンドウ、または /out スイッチで指定された任意のログ ファイルに表示できます。Summary information for builds, including errors, can be displayed in the command window, or in any log file specified with the /out switch.

Example

次のコマンドでは、"MySolution" の "Debug" ソリューション構成内の "Debug" プロジェクト ビルド構成を使用し、プロジェクト "CSharpConsoleApp" がビルドされます。The following command builds the project "CSharpConsoleApp", using the "Debug" project build configuration within the "Debug" solution configuration of "MySolution":

devenv "C:\Visual Studio Projects\MySolution\MySolution.sln" /build Debug /project "CSharpWinApp\CSharpWinApp.csproj" /projectconfig Debug

関連項目See also